导航栏中的带有操作按钮的另一个视图

时间:2020-04-17 02:33:25

标签: swift swiftui

我想使用一个NavigationBarItems中的按钮打开一个新视图。我把我的代码。感谢您的帮助。

struct ClienteView: View {
    var body: some View {
        NavigationView {
            List(clientes) { cliente in
                NavigationLink(destination: DetallesClienteView(objCliente: cliente)){
                    DetallesCliente(objCliente: cliente)
                }
            }
            .navigationBarTitle(Text("Clientes"), displayMode: .inline)
            .navigationBarItems(trailing:
                Button(action: {

                }) {
                    Image(systemName: "person.badge.plus")
                }
            )
        }
    }
}

1 个答案:

答案 0 :(得分:0)

您可以做这种事情:

.navigationBarItems(trailing:
    NavigationLink(destination: SecondView(), label: {
        Image(systemName: "person.badge.plus")
    })
)